Elior Stadia - Bringing the Buzz to Matchdays & More
Take the lead behind the bars at the iconic Murrayfield Stadium! Join us as a Bar Manager and play a key role in delivering standout hospitality at one of Scotland's most prestigious venues. From match days to conferences and high-profile events, you'll lead from the front, keeping operations running smoothly, supporting your team, and ensuring excellence.

How to prepare for a job interview at Elior
✨Know Your Venue
Familiarise yourself with Murrayfield Stadium and its unique atmosphere. Understand the types of events held there and how your role as a Bar Manager can enhance the experience for guests. This knowledge will show your passion and commitment to the position.
✨Showcase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team in a busy bar environment. Highlight your ability to motivate staff, manage conflicts, and ensure smooth operations during peak times. This will demonstrate that you can handle the pressures of match days and high-profile events.
✨Emphasise Customer Service
Be ready to discuss your approach to delivering exceptional customer service. Share specific instances where you went above and beyond to ensure guest satisfaction. This is crucial in a hospitality role, especially in a vibrant setting like a stadium.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the bar operations at Murrayfield and the expectations for the Bar Manager role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you. Plus, it gives you a chance to engage with the interviewers.
